Output 3fc38b60206b6754c1c87bca75aea2584dbe4e540cd1d98dfa31ed32c85e7006:13

value
67632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90a4a6f8eee78a6e4d1111b5407e15bcc1b1bc56 OP_EQUAL
address
3EspUQTWAWejrVdRAsPqaTdR2oRCBtQaZC
transaction
3fc38b60206b6754c1c87bca75aea2584dbe4e540cd1d98dfa31ed32c85e7006
spent
true